2007年へ/ 2008年へ/ 2009年へ/ 2010年へ/ 2011年へ/ 2012年へ/
2009-03-27[n年前へ]
■Google Chromeのフォントやグラフィックレンダリング機構
Google Chromeのフォントやグラフィックレンダリング機構
グラフィックス描画エンジンも、独自ライブラリを使っている例だ。Google Chromeではテキスト以外のグラフィックのレンダリングには、2005年にグーグルが買収したSkiaという会社の同名のエンジンを使っている。なぜ、WindowsのGDIではないのか? ChromiumコミュニティのSkiaの解説ページには、その理由がいくつか書いてある。1つは、Windowsが提供するAPIのGDIが、SVGやCanvasの実装には機能が不十分であること。もう1 つは、マイクロソフトによるGDI+の開発が止まっていて、ほとんどのグラフィック操作でSkiaよりも遅いことを挙げている。